Question
A compound (A) of boron reacts with NMe3 to give an adduct (B) which on hydrolysis gives a compound (C) and hydrogen gas. Compound (C) is an acid. Identify the compounds A, B and C. Give the reactions involved.

Solution
\[\ce{B2H6 (A) + 2NMe3 -> 2BH3NMe3 (B)}\]
\[\ce{BH3NHe3 + H2O -> H3BO3 (C) + NMe3 + 6H2}\]
(A): B2H6
(B): 2BH3NMe3
(C): H3BO3
